Vegan Bulgogi Lettuce Wraps- a vegan version of traditional Korean barbecue made with marinated mushrooms and tofu. You won't miss the meat in these delicious wraps! Super simple, tasty (and low carb!) bulgogi lettuce wraps consist of succulent, marinated meat (most commonly beef or pork) wrapped in a piece of leafy, green lettuce. Korean barbecue sauce lends sweet and savory elements to the beef in these easy lettuce wraps.
